Перейти к содержанию
Авторизация  
Сухроб

GPS | Навигатор

Рекомендуемые сообщения

Сухроб

Здравствуйте! Помогите пожалуйста, когда прибываешь на чекпоинт, автоматом чекпоинт выключился и вводилось сообщения "Вы прибыли на место назначения"

if(dialogid == 40)
    {
        if(response)
         {
             if(listitem == 0)
             {
                SetPlayerCheckpoint(playerid,1904.4252,2246.4707,15.7163,5);
                S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. АвтоШкола г.Батырево,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
               }
               if(listitem == 1)
               {
                   SetPlayerCheckpoint(playerid,2381.6421,-1905.3323,22.6751,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. Банк г.Южный,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 2)
               {
                   SetPlayerCheckpoint(playerid,315.8571,494.8022,12.8752,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. Банк г.Арзамас,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 3)
               {
                   SetPlayerCheckpoint(playerid,346.7891,1633.6816,12.3294,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. Паспортный стол г.Арзамас (Мэрия), от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 4)
               {
                   SetPlayerCheckpoint(playerid,-877.1667,1951.1659,45.8452,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. Рублёвка,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 5)
               {
                   SetPlayerCheckpoint(playerid,-456.3892,990.9753,12.6477,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. ОГИБДД г.Арзамас,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 6)
               {
                   SetPlayerCheckpoint(playerid,2576.2334,-2415.9739,22.4951,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. Полиция ГУВД г.Южный,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 7)
               {
                   SetPlayerCheckpoint(playerid,2114.2974,-2391.0647,23.0883,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. Скорая помощь,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 8)
               {
                   SetPlayerCheckpoint(playerid,2142.4785,-1847.1185,18.8213,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. СТО | Механики,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 9)
               {
                   SetPlayerCheckpoint(playerid,-1038.6346,2169.6912,38.0395,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. Дальнобойщики,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 10)
               {
                   SetPlayerCheckpoint(playerid,1755.2278,2252.9678,15.8606,5);
                   SendClientMessage(playerid, COLOR_PURPLE, "{FFFFFF}Вы указали точку пути:. АТП, отправляйтесь на {FF0000}красный маркер{FFFFFF} в вашем навигаторе!");
                return 0;
            }
            if(listitem == 11)
               {
                   DisablePlayerCheckpoint(playerid);
                   SendClientMessage(playerid, COLOR_PURPLE, "Маркер установлен. Система отключена.");
                return 0;
            }
          }
          else
          {
        }
       }

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
SCRIPTMAN

В OnPlayerEnterCheckpoint вставь: 

SendClientMessage(playerid, цвет, "Твой текст, когда игрок стал на чекпоинт. Тип: "Вы прибыли в место назначения!""");
DisablePlayerCheckpoint(playerid);

Вроде так. Чирикал с браузера

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
Гость
Эта тема закрыта для публикации ответов.
Авторизация  

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×

Важная информация

Мы разместили cookie-файлы на ваше устройство, чтобы помочь сделать этот сайт лучше. Вы можете изменить свои настройки cookie-файлов, или продолжить без изменения настроек.